APPEARANCE

Adder is a 31 year old human male, with gray eyes and brown hair, though he keeps his head shaved. He often has stubble on his face. His skin is a tan yellow, reflecting his mixed Baklunish and Oerid heritage.

At 5'9" and 220 lbs, many jokingly consider him to be an oversize dwarf without the beard, but no one dismisses his physical toughness or his professional conduct. Many a time he has taken magical abuse from his own party that would fell lesser men (at least three fireballs and one call lightning). Indeed, his professional conduct was one of the things that led to a conflict with his own mercenary band, and resulted in his imprisonment by an employer.  In dress, Adder looks more like a sailor or pirate with his bandana, tight pants, and loose shirt and vest. He is often expressionless and moves casually and deliberately. His eyes are cold and calculating.

BACKGROUND/HISTORY

Adar Pelgrin was born in the town of Exag, which lies in the Mounds of Dawn in northwestern Perrenland. 

Mispronunciation led to his nickname, "Adder". Adder entered the mercenaries in 572 at the age of 17, and served two years as a crossbowmen, seeing limited action in the Yatils. Leaving the army of Perrenland in 574, Adder continued to improve his fighting skills in Schwartzenbruin under the tutelage of Hellas Damthar. 575 C.Y. found Adder several hundred miles south in Flen as a bodyguard to a young nobleman mage named Methas, who in turn eventually formed a mercenary adventuring company in late 575 C.Y.

Over the next 8 years and a change of career in 577 C.Y., this adventuring company would range as far as Molag, Westkeep, and Lopolla. Eventually several unfortunate incidents and personality conflicts caused the group to disband in no uncertain terms in 583 C.Y.

By this time, Adder was of sufficient experience to run a guild of his own if he so desired, and after consulting with his own Guildmaster, Farn Ghenig, he left Keoland and jouneyed north. In late 583 C.Y., he found himself in Molvar as one of the Guild Masters at the Palace of Shadows, a pre-eminent school for thieves, spies, and assassins in Ket.

However, he was dissatisfied with his occupation, and left in early 585 C.Y., heading south again to Keoland and Flen.

RECENT HISTORY

Adder found interesting employment in the service of the Keoish spymaster, Thoggin Oakley, and has since joined one of Thoggin's units, Griffin Team, hunting a Scarlet Brotherhood spy in Gradsul.
